:root{--cron-primary:#6366f1;--cron-primary-rgb:99, 102, 241;--cron-primary-light:#6366f114;--cron-text:#1e293b;--cron-text-secondary:#475569;--cron-text-muted:#64748b;--cron-bg:#fff;--cron-bg-subtle:#f8fafc;--cron-bg-hover:#6366f10a;--cron-border:#e2e8f0;--cron-border-light:#0000000f;--cron-card-shadow:0 1px 2px #0000000a, 0 4px 12px #0000000a;--cron-radius:8px;--cron-radius-lg:12px;--cron-success:#10b981;--cron-success-light:#10b9811a;--cron-error:#ef4444;--cron-error-light:#ef44441a;--cron-color-minute:#6366f1;--cron-color-hour:#0ea5e9;--cron-color-dom:#f59e0b;--cron-color-month:#10b981;--cron-color-dow:#ec4899}._cron-container{flex-direction:column;gap:1.25rem;max-width:860px;margin:0 auto;display:flex}._cron-btn{border-radius:var(--cron-radius);cursor:pointer;white-space:nowrap;border:none;align-items:center;gap:.375rem;padding:.5625rem 1.125rem;font-size:.8125rem;font-weight:500;transition:opacity .15s,box-shadow .15s;display:inline-flex}._cron-btn:hover{opacity:.85}._cron-btn-primary{background:var(--cron-primary);color:#fff;box-shadow:0 2px 8px rgba(var(--cron-primary-rgb), .25)}._cron-btn-secondary{background:var(--cron-bg);color:var(--cron-text-secondary);border-style:solid;border-width:1.5px;border-color:var(--cron-border)}._cron-btn-secondary:hover{border-color:rgba(var(--cron-primary-rgb), .3);color:var(--cron-primary)}._cron-btn-sm{padding:.375rem .75rem;font-size:.75rem}._cron-main-grid{grid-template-columns:1fr 280px;align-items:start;gap:1.25rem;display:grid}._cron-card{background:var(--cron-bg);border-radius:var(--cron-radius-lg);border-style:solid;border-width:1px;border-color:var(--cron-border);box-shadow:var(--cron-card-shadow)}@media (max-width:768px){._cron-container{padding-left:1rem;padding-right:1rem}._cron-main-grid{grid-template-columns:1fr}}._cron-expression-card{background:var(--cron-bg);border-radius:var(--cron-radius-lg);border-style:solid;border-width:1px;border-color:var(--cron-border);box-shadow:var(--cron-card-shadow);padding:1.5rem}._cron-expression-display{justify-content:center;align-items:center;gap:1rem;display:flex}._cron-expression-fields{align-items:center;gap:.5rem;display:flex}._cron-field-group{flex-direction:column;align-items:center;gap:.25rem;display:flex}._cron-field-input{text-align:center;width:72px;font-family:var(--main-font-mono);color:var(--cron-text);background:var(--cron-bg-subtle);border-style:solid;border-width:2px;border-color:var(--cron-border);border-radius:var(--cron-radius);outline:none;padding:.5rem .25rem;font-size:1.125rem;font-weight:600;transition:border-color .15s,box-shadow .15s}._cron-field-input:focus{box-shadow:0 0 0 3px rgba(var(--cron-primary-rgb), .1)}._cron-field--minute{border-color:#6366f14d}._cron-field--minute:focus{border-color:var(--cron-color-minute);box-shadow:0 0 0 3px #6366f126}._cron-field--hour{border-color:#0ea5e94d}._cron-field--hour:focus{border-color:var(--cron-color-hour);box-shadow:0 0 0 3px #0ea5e926}._cron-field--dom{border-color:#f59e0b4d}._cron-field--dom:focus{border-color:var(--cron-color-dom);box-shadow:0 0 0 3px #f59e0b26}._cron-field--month{border-color:#10b9814d}._cron-field--month:focus{border-color:var(--cron-color-month);box-shadow:0 0 0 3px #10b98126}._cron-field--dow{border-color:#ec48994d}._cron-field--dow:focus{border-color:var(--cron-color-dow);box-shadow:0 0 0 3px #ec489926}._cron-field-label{color:var(--cron-text-muted);font-size:.6875rem;font-weight:500}._cron-expression-actions{flex-shrink:0}._cron-description{text-align:center;color:var(--cron-text-secondary);min-height:1.5em;margin-top:.875rem;font-size:.9375rem;line-height:1.5}._cron-validation{text-align:center;color:var(--cron-error);background:var(--cron-error-light);border-radius:var(--cron-radius);margin-top:.5rem;padding:.375rem .75rem;font-size:.8125rem}._cron-presets{flex-wrap:wrap;justify-content:center;gap:.5rem;display:flex}._cron-preset{color:var(--cron-text-secondary);background:var(--cron-bg);border-style:solid;border-width:1px;border-color:var(--cron-border);border-radius:var(--main-radius-full,9999px);cursor:pointer;white-space:nowrap;padding:.3125rem .75rem;font-size:.75rem;font-weight:500;transition:all .15s}._cron-preset:hover{border-color:rgba(var(--cron-primary-rgb), .3);color:var(--cron-primary);background:var(--cron-bg-hover)}._cron-preset.is-active{border-color:var(--cron-primary);color:var(--cron-primary);background:var(--cron-primary-light)}@media (max-width:768px){._cron-expression-card{padding:1rem}._cron-expression-display{flex-direction:column;gap:.75rem}._cron-expression-fields{gap:.25rem}._cron-field-input{width:56px;padding:.375rem .125rem;font-size:.9375rem}._cron-field-label{font-size:.5625rem}._cron-presets{gap:.375rem}._cron-preset{padding:.25rem .625rem;font-size:.6875rem}}._cron-builder-card{background:var(--cron-bg);border-radius:var(--cron-radius-lg);border-style:solid;border-width:1px;border-color:var(--cron-border);box-shadow:var(--cron-card-shadow)}._cron-builder-sections{flex-direction:column;min-height:480px;display:flex}._cron-builder-section{border-bottom-style:solid;border-bottom-width:1px;border-bottom-color:var(--cron-border);padding:.875rem 1.25rem}._cron-builder-section:last-child{border-bottom:none}._cron-builder-header{align-items:center;gap:.5rem;margin-bottom:.625rem;display:flex}._cron-builder-dot{border-radius:50%;flex-shrink:0;width:8px;height:8px}._cron-builder-dot--minute{background:var(--cron-color-minute)}._cron-builder-dot--hour{background:var(--cron-color-hour)}._cron-builder-dot--dom{background:var(--cron-color-dom)}._cron-builder-dot--month{background:var(--cron-color-month)}._cron-builder-dot--dow{background:var(--cron-color-dow)}._cron-builder-name{color:var(--cron-text);font-size:.8125rem;font-weight:600}._cron-builder-range{color:var(--cron-text-muted);font-size:.6875rem;font-family:var(--main-font-mono);margin-left:auto}._cron-mode-tabs{background:var(--cron-bg-subtle);border-radius:var(--cron-radius);gap:.25rem;margin-bottom:.625rem;padding:.1875rem;display:flex}._cron-mode-tab{color:var(--cron-text-muted);cursor:pointer;text-align:center;white-space:nowrap;background:0 0;border:none;border-radius:6px;flex:1;padding:.3125rem .5rem;font-size:.6875rem;font-weight:500;transition:all .15s}._cron-mode-tab:hover{color:var(--cron-text-secondary)}._cron-mode-tab.is-active{background:var(--cron-bg);color:var(--cron-primary);box-shadow:0 1px 3px #00000014}._cron-mode-content{min-height:2rem}._cron-mode-panel{display:none}._cron-mode-panel.is-active{display:block}._cron-every-n{color:var(--cron-text-secondary);align-items:center;gap:.5rem;font-size:.8125rem;display:flex}._cron-every-n-input{text-align:center;width:60px;font-family:var(--main-font-mono);color:var(--cron-text);background:var(--cron-bg);border-style:solid;border-width:1.5px;border-color:var(--cron-border);border-radius:var(--cron-radius);outline:none;padding:.3125rem .5rem;font-size:.8125rem;transition:border-color .15s}._cron-every-n-input:focus{border-color:var(--cron-primary);box-shadow:0 0 0 3px rgba(var(--cron-primary-rgb), .1)}._cron-specific-grid{flex-wrap:wrap;gap:.25rem;display:flex}._cron-specific-item{width:32px;height:28px;font-size:.6875rem;font-family:var(--main-font-mono);color:var(--cron-text-secondary);background:var(--cron-bg-subtle);cursor:pointer;-webkit-user-select:none;user-select:none;border:1px solid #0000;border-radius:6px;justify-content:center;align-items:center;transition:all .15s;display:flex}._cron-specific-item:hover{border-color:rgba(var(--cron-primary-rgb), .3);color:var(--cron-text)}._cron-specific-item.is-selected{background:var(--cron-primary);color:#fff;border-color:var(--cron-primary);font-weight:600}._cron-specific-item--wide{width:auto;min-width:36px;padding:0 .375rem}._cron-range-row{color:var(--cron-text-secondary);align-items:center;gap:.5rem;font-size:.8125rem;display:flex}._cron-range-input{text-align:center;width:60px;font-family:var(--main-font-mono);color:var(--cron-text);background:var(--cron-bg);border-style:solid;border-width:1.5px;border-color:var(--cron-border);border-radius:var(--cron-radius);outline:none;padding:.3125rem .5rem;font-size:.8125rem;transition:border-color .15s}._cron-range-input:focus{border-color:var(--cron-primary);box-shadow:0 0 0 3px rgba(var(--cron-primary-rgb), .1)}._cron-every-info{color:var(--cron-text-muted);font-size:.8125rem;font-style:italic}@media (max-width:768px){._cron-builder-section{padding:.75rem 1rem}._cron-specific-item{width:28px;height:26px;font-size:.625rem}._cron-mode-tab{padding:.25rem .375rem;font-size:.625rem}}._cron-next-card{background:var(--cron-bg);border-radius:var(--cron-radius-lg);border-style:solid;border-width:1px;border-color:var(--cron-border);box-shadow:var(--cron-card-shadow)}._cron-next-header{border-bottom-style:solid;border-bottom-width:1px;border-bottom-color:var(--cron-border);padding:.875rem 1.25rem}._cron-next-title{color:var(--cron-text);font-size:.8125rem;font-weight:600}._cron-next-list{min-height:200px;padding:.5rem 0}._cron-next-item{align-items:center;gap:.75rem;padding:.5rem 1.25rem;font-size:.8125rem;display:flex}._cron-next-item+._cron-next-item{border-top-style:solid;border-top-width:1px;border-top-color:var(--cron-border-light)}._cron-next-index{color:var(--cron-text-muted);text-align:center;flex-shrink:0;width:18px;font-size:.6875rem;font-weight:600}._cron-next-datetime{font-family:var(--main-font-mono);color:var(--cron-text);font-size:.8125rem}._cron-next-relative{color:var(--cron-text-muted);white-space:nowrap;margin-left:auto;font-size:.6875rem}._cron-next-empty{text-align:center;color:var(--cron-text-muted);padding:2rem 1.25rem;font-size:.8125rem}._cron-cheatsheet-card{background:var(--cron-bg);border-radius:var(--cron-radius-lg);border-style:solid;border-width:1px;border-color:var(--cron-border);box-shadow:var(--cron-card-shadow)}._cron-cheatsheet-toggle{cursor:pointer;width:100%;color:var(--cron-text);background:0 0;border:none;justify-content:space-between;align-items:center;padding:.875rem 1.25rem;display:flex}._cron-cheatsheet-toggle:hover{opacity:.8}._cron-cheatsheet-title{font-size:.875rem;font-weight:600}._cron-toggle-icon{color:var(--cron-text-muted);align-items:center;transition:transform .2s;display:flex}._cron-toggle-icon.is-open{transform:rotate(180deg)}._cron-cheatsheet-body{gap:1.25rem;padding:0 1.25rem 1.25rem;display:flex}._cron-cheatsheet-table{border-collapse:collapse;flex:1;font-size:.75rem}._cron-cheatsheet-table th{text-align:left;color:var(--cron-text);border-bottom-style:solid;border-bottom-width:1px;border-bottom-color:var(--cron-border);padding:.375rem .5rem;font-weight:600}._cron-cheatsheet-table td{color:var(--cron-text-secondary);padding:.3125rem .5rem}._cron-cheatsheet-table code{font-family:var(--main-font-mono);color:var(--cron-primary);background:var(--cron-primary-light);border-radius:4px;padding:.125rem .375rem;font-size:.75rem}@media (max-width:768px){._cron-cheatsheet-body{flex-direction:column;gap:1rem}._cron-next-item{padding:.5rem 1rem}._cron-next-relative{display:none}}
